How much do entry level walmart hvac j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 29,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level walmart hvac in Springfield, IL is $19.40,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.28 and $21.92 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an entry level Walmart HVAC technician do?

An entry level Walmart HVAC technician assists with the installation, maintenance, and repair of he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ems in Walmart stores. Their tasks include inspecting HVAC units, performing routine maintenance, troubleshooting issues, and supporting experienced technicians with larger repairs. They help ensure that the store environment remains comfortable and systems operate efficiently. Training and supervision are provided, making this an ideal starting point for those interested in the HVAC field.

How to become a Walmart HVAC technician?

To become a Walmart HVAC technician, you typ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, followed by completing an HVAC training program or apprenticeship. Certification from organizations like EPA Section 608 is often required, along with relevant work experience in he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ems. Maintaining technical skills and staying current with industry standards are essential for this role.

What is the difference between Entry Level Walmart Hvac vs Entry Level Walmart Refrigeration Technician?

AspectEntry Level Walmart HvacEntry Level Walmart Refrigeration Technician
CertificationsEPA 608 Certification, HVAC trainingEPA 608 Certification, Refrigeration training
Work EnvironmentRetail stores, maintenance areasRetail stores, refrigeration units
Industry UsageHVAC systems, air conditioning, heatingRefrigeration systems, coolers, freezers

Both roles involve maintaining and repairing systems within Walmart stores. The HVAC technician focuses on he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ems, while the refrigeration technician specializes in refrigeration units like coolers and freezers. Certifications and work environments overlap significantly, but the specific systems they service differ, guiding the choice based on your interest in air systems versus refrigeration.
